Related Serv ices definition

Related Serv ices means the serv ices incid ental to the supply of the goods, such as insurance, installation, trainin g and initial maintenan ce and other such obligations of the Supplier under the Contract.
Related Serv ices means the serv ices incidental to the supply of the goods, such as transportation, insurance, installation, training and initial maintenance and other such obligations of the Supplier under the Contract.
